Edit a category to search:
select other


Markets in Leeds, UT

Leeds Market
261 N Main StLeeds, UT, 84746
4358798695
FoodGrocery StoreGrocery StoresGrocery Stores/EmploymentLins Market PlaceShoppingSupermarketsVons Safeway Grocery Store